Examining the Condition of Your Siding
How can home owners precisely identify the state of their siding? To assess the condition of siding, house owners must begin with a comprehensive aesthetic examination. This includes checking for obvious indications of damage, such as splits, warping, or discoloration. They must also seek loose panels or sections that may have come separated. Furthermore, homeowners need to examine the caulking and seals around doors and windows, as wear and tear in these locations can suggest underlying issues. It is useful to examine the siding during different weather, as dampness or sunshine can expose issues not visible in completely dry, cloudy weather. Ideally, home owners can conduct a dampness meter test to identify trapped moisture that might bring about mold or rot. Lastly, looking for expert guidance can give an expert examination, ensuring that any prospective problems are addressed quickly. This aggressive approach helps keep the honesty and look of the home.
Common Types of Siding Damages
Siding damage can materialize in different kinds, each calling for certain interest to preserve the home's exterior. Typical types consist of bending, which often occurs as a result of extended exposure to wetness or extreme temperatures, compromising the siding's structural integrity. Fractures and splits can develop from temperature fluctuations or physical influences, causing added degeneration if left unaddressed. Insect invasions, particularly from termites, can create substantial damages, requiring immediate treatment to secure the home. Fading and discoloration from UV exposure detracts from curb appeal and might suggest the need for painting or replacement. Tools and Products Needed for Repair
A successful siding repair task depends upon having the right devices and products at hand. Necessary tools include a gauging tape for accurate dimensions, an energy knife for cutting siding, and a lever for removing damaged sections. A degree warranties proper positioning throughout installation, while a hammer and nails or a nail gun facilitate protected fastening.
In regards to products, house owners should gather substitute siding that matches the existing product, whether it be vinyl, timber, or fiber concrete. Caulk and paint are necessary for sealing spaces and ending up touches, assuring a smooth appearance. Additionally, security gear such as handwear covers and safety glasses is essential to protect against debris and sharp edges.

Age of Siding
The age of siding plays a substantial duty in establishing whether substitute is needed. Commonly, siding products have varying life expectancies; as an example, timber siding might last around 20 to 40 years, while plastic can withstand for 30 to 50 years. As siding ages, it might shed its protective qualities, leading to concerns such as bending, fading, or breaking. Property owners should additionally take into consideration the frequency of maintenance and repairs; if fixings are coming to be a lot more frequent, it could indicate the need for an upgrade. In addition, obsolete siding can diminish a home's aesthetic charm, making replacement an appealing alternative. Assessing both the age and problem of the siding is necessary for making an educated choice concerning replacement.
Picking the Right Siding Material for Your Home
Picking the proper siding material can considerably enhance a home's visual and structural honesty. Property owners must take into consideration various variables, including environment, budget, and wanted appearance. Plastic siding offers cost and reduced maintenance, making it a preferred choice. Timber siding gives a classic, all-natural appearance but needs extra upkeep. Fiber cement siding incorporates resilience with convenience, mimicking the appearance of timber while standing up to pests and rot.
Furthermore, rock or block veneers can include a touch of beauty and durability. It's critical to evaluate insulation residential properties and power efficiency, as these can significantly affect heating & cooling prices. Preserving Your Siding for Long-Term Visual Charm
How can homeowners guarantee their siding keeps its allure for many years? Routine maintenance is vital for preserving siding's visual and practical high qualities. Homeowners should schedule yearly evaluations to identify issues such as splits, peeling off paint, or mold growth. Without delay resolving these issues avoids further damages and improves curb allure.
Cleaning up the siding a minimum of two times a year is likewise necessary. Making use of mild pressure cleaning or a soft brush with mild cleaning agent assists remove dust and mildew. Additionally, home owners must keep seamless gutters clear to prevent water damage, which can negatively influence siding honesty.
Using protective coverings or sealers can lengthen the life of products like wood or plastic. Making particular appropriate ventilation in attic rooms and crawl rooms lessens wetness build-up, which can wear away siding over time.
